glad it all worked out for u in the end mate. But I do hear your pain about being scammed/duped into handing over money and never receiving the goods.

What I would like to propose to the moderators (from experience on the g35driver.com forums) is that on each ad placed in the "for sale" forum that it is mandatory to place a picture of the item with a placard displaying the forum members user-id and current date. Doesn't have to be anything fancy, but something in whiteboard marker on an A4 placed next to the item and a photo taken so it clearly shows both the item and seller details.

That way ppl can't grab pictures over the internet and claim to possess the items for sale. Sure they will be ppl saying well you can photoshop the details on the photo...but its more a deterent to scammers
